Job Description

This role offers flexibility for hybrid working.

We're partnering with a highly respected, values-driven financial planning firm that is looking to add a Senior Paraplanner to its growing team.

This is far more than a traditional report-writing role.

You'll work closely with the MD and the Financial Planner to develop holistic financial planning strategies for high-net-worth clients, identify planning opportunities, undertake complex technical research, and play a key role in shaping client recommendations.

The business prides itself on delivering genuinely personalised advice and fostering a collaborative culture where ideas are welcomed, development is encouraged, and technical excellence is valued.

What makes this opportunity different?Work with high-net-worth clients on complex planning cases Genuine influence over recommendations and client outcomes Collaborative and supportive team culture Ongoing professional development and progression support Opportunity to contribute to business improvement and strategic initiatives A company that is not looking for a quick hire but are prepared to wait for the right person We're keen to speak with Diploma-qualified paraplanners, ideally who have or are keen to work towards Chartered status.

You will need strong technical knowledge across pensions, investments, retirement planning, tax, and estate planning, and be passionate about delivering exceptional client outcomes.

If you're looking for a long-term career paraplanning opportunity with a company that values expertise, curiosity, and doing the right thing, we'd love to hear from you.
